Marmot Phenomenon EL Jacket “(Santa Rosa, CA – October 20, 2003) The Marmot Project Team, the W.L. Gore & Associates, Inc. Advance Development Group and the R&D department of Novatech Electro-Luminescent, Inc. of Chino, California, are collaborating in the development of a new, wearable technology concept garment named the Phenomenon EL. This advance concept garment features the latest development in safety and close proximity illumination for the wearer without any adverse weight penalty. Electroluminescent (EL) panels are strategically integrated into this Marmot waterproof/breathable all-weather GORE-TEX® XCR® performance shell concept garment to provide visibility and identification at great distance at night.
